## Break-Glass: Sockethatch Reconnect Bug

Heads up for the weekly sync: the Sockethatch gateway still drops websocket reconnects when clients resume within the 5-second grace window, stranding them in a zombie session. The fix is merged but not shipped, so until then the mitigation is manual: break-glass into the gateway admin shell and run `sockethatch flush-sessions`. Normal auth is disabled on that shell by design (it bypasses Quillgate SSO entirely). To open the break-glass shell, enter the recovery passphrase below.

strongbox words: briiel-zoreth-noveth-pelys-druwyn-feniel-lamvan-ulaius-kasion

[ ] Key ceremony step 7 — Cron-to-Fenwright migration sign-off. Before we rotate the signing keys, confirm every plugin's cron job has a matching Fenwright workflow and the old crontab entries are commented out, not deleted (we may roll back). Plugin authors: your schedules must declare idempotency or they won't be migrated. Two witnesses initial the checklist, then the lead unseals the ceremony vault. That unseal step requires the recovery passphrase below.

recovery phrase for fahif-hadup: sorix-holael

### Encoding detection fallback

When the Glyphsage detector cannot confidently classify an uploaded text file, it falls back to the internal Charset Oracle service rather than guessing. This fallback added roughly 40ms at p95 last week, which we will discuss at the sync. Calls to the Oracle require authentication, and the current key is shown below.

gateway credential: kto3_qfe

14:22 — Deploy of the Wrenhall validator plugin host began. The loader resolved plugins by filename order, so the new schema validator shadowed the legacy one silently. No errors surfaced; records passed with partial checks for nine minutes until alerts fired. Rollback started at 14:31. The affected artifact is identified by the token below.

build token for fawef-bawif: htk21_a456c2b3baaca3c947e20

## 2.9.0 — Setting renamed

The Quillgate audit-log viewer setting previously known as VIEWER_ACCESS_CODE has been renamed to reflect its actual role as a signing secret for export links. Plugin authors who read the old variable should migrate now; the legacy name will be ignored in 3.0, and exports signed with it will fail validation. Update your integration's environment file so the renamed variable appears directly below this note, like so:

sealed setting: ARCHIVE_KEY3=8d0